Diversity and Inclusion Sessions at ESPC22

Becoming authentic, always learning and mastering your power skills are mantras for the modern professional. But how?

Join Heather Cook, Principal PM, Business Applications & Platform Community, Microsoft and Karuana Gatimu, Principal PM, Customer Advocacy Group for Microsoft Teams Engineering. They will host three guided workshops in our Community Area on Leadership, Networking, and Mentoring so that you can build confidence in these areas.

Heather and Karuana will also dive into new programs regarding how to best leverage and join Microsoft Community programs and platforms.  

Define Your Leadership Style

At the Leadership Workshop, Heather and Karuana will discuss how showing respect, empathy, and kindness builds trust across your team.

“We will discuss tactics for establishing your base of knowledge in your field, how to give your team autonomy, how to build authentic communication and how to lead with compassion. All of which are tools for becoming a great leader” – Heather and Karuana.

Become a Pro at Networking

At the Networking Workshop, Karuana and Heather will discuss networking skills for both introverts and extroverts. Explore ways to be comfortable in first-time meetings. In turn, deepen your professional relationships.

“Networking is about listening as much as it is about talking. We’ll look at how to create your “why” elevator pitch and a list of tactics to take with you for all your networking moments” – Heather and Karuana.

Develop Your Mentoring Skills

At the Mentoring Workshop, Heather and Karuana will discuss the benefits of both being and having a mentor. Having an outside eye to your career from both perspectives is crucial to your growth. Anyone who’s ever participated in mentoring will tell you that.

“We learn when we teach and we teach when we learn” – Heather and Karuana.
